1. Artificial Intelligence (AI): The Rise of General AI
Artificial intelligence (AI) has been a buzzword for many years, but by 2025, AI is becoming even more integrated into our daily lives. In particular, we are seeing a shift from narrow AI, which is designed to perform specific tasks, to the more advanced concept of general AI. This type of AI can perform a variety of tasks with the level of competency typically associated with human intelligence.

Key AI Applications in 2025:
- Healthcare: AI is revolutionizing the healthcare industry, with AI-driven diagnostics, personalized medicine, and drug discovery. In 2025, AI-powered systems are capable of diagnosing diseases with extraordinary accuracy, analyzing genetic data to recommend personalized treatment plans, and even predicting potential health risks before they manifest.
- Customer Service and Retail: AI-powered chatbots and virtual assistants are now able to engage in highly sophisticated conversations, providing customer support and even predicting consumer behavior to suggest personalized products and services. This not only enhances the customer experience but also optimizes business operations.
- Creative Industries: AI is also making waves in creative fields such as art, music, and writing. AI-generated art and music are gaining popularity, with algorithms capable of producing pieces that are almost indistinguishable from human-created works. This has sparked discussions around the intersection of creativity and automation.
By 2025, AI is no longer a tool confined to specific industries; it is an essential part of how businesses operate, deliver services, and innovate.
2. Quantum Computing: Unlocking Unimaginable Potential
Quantum computing is another area where the future is rapidly unfolding in 2025. Quantum computers, which leverage the principles of quantum mechanics to process information, are solving problems that are beyond the capabilities of classical computers. Although still in its early stages, quantum computing is expected to have profound implications for various industries.
Breakthrough Applications of Quantum Computing:
- Drug Discovery: In healthcare, quantum computers are accelerating the process of drug discovery. By simulating molecular interactions at an unprecedented scale, quantum computers allow researchers to create drugs that target specific diseases with greater precision and fewer side effects.
- Climate Modeling: Quantum computers are also being used to simulate complex climate models, helping researchers understand the long-term effects of climate change. These simulations can help policymakers make more informed decisions about environmental sustainability and disaster mitigation.
- Cybersecurity: While quantum computing presents potential risks to current encryption methods, it also offers the possibility of creating more secure systems. Quantum encryption methods, such as quantum key distribution, are set to revolutionize cybersecurity by making it virtually impossible to hack sensitive data.
In 2025, quantum computing is still in its infancy but is expected to open new frontiers in science, medicine, and security, making previously unsolvable problems accessible.
3. The Metaverse: A New Digital Universe
The metaverse—a collective virtual shared space created by the convergence of virtually enhanced physical reality and physically persistent virtual worlds—has moved from concept to reality by 2025. This immersive digital universe allows people to interact, socialize, and conduct business in a fully realized virtual world. Powered by vir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), and spatial computing, the metaverse is quickly becoming a central hub for entertainment, work, and commerce.
Key Developments in the Metaverse:
- Work in the Metaverse: Remote work has evolved, and by 2025, companies are increasingly using the metaverse for virtual offices. Employees, using VR headsets and motion tracking devices, can interact with their colleagues in virtual spaces as though they were physically present. This creates a sense of presence and collaboration that was previously impossible in remote work environments.
- Virtual Economy: The metaverse is home to a thriving virtual economy, where digital goods, real estate, and services are bought, sold, and traded. Virtual currencies like cryptocurrency are facilitating these transactions, and digital assets are becoming increasingly valuable. Virtual land ownership, for instance, is a booming industry, with companies and individuals investing in digital properties to build virtual businesses or social spaces.
- Gaming and Social Interaction: The gaming industry has fully embraced the metaverse, with immersive gaming experiences that allow players to interact in vast, persistent worlds. Beyond gaming, virtual concerts, live events, and social gatherings are becoming a popular part of online life.
By 2025, the metaverse is not just an entertainment platform but is becoming a fundamental layer of digital interaction in professional, social, and personal contexts.
4. 5G and Beyond: The Power of Connectivity
The rollout of 5G networks continues to accelerate, and by 2025, 5G is the standard for internet connectivity worldwide. The increased bandwidth and reduced latency of 5G networks are enabling innovations in a variety of fields, from autonomous driving to the Internet of Things (IoT).
Impact of 5G on Industries:
- Smart Cities: 5G is at the heart of smart city initiatives, connecting everything from traffic lights and public transportation to power grids and waste management systems. This enables more efficient and sustainable cities, reducing energy consumption and improving quality of life.
- Healthcare: In healthcare, 5G enables real-time remote monitoring of patients, the remote operation of surgical robots, and faster transmission of medical data, which can be crucial in emergencies. This allows for telemedicine to expand and improves access to healthcare in underserved regions.
- Autonomous Vehicles: 5G is also playing a crucial role in the development of autonomous vehicles. Self-driving cars and trucks rely on real-time communication with infrastructure, other vehicles, and pedestrians to navigate safely. With 5G’s ultra-low latency, these systems can operate seamlessly and safely.
By 2025, 5G is fundamentally transforming how people interact with the world, enabling new technologies and services that rely on high-speed, low-latency connectivity.
5. Sustainable Technologies: The Green Revolution
In 2025, sustainability is no longer a niche concern but a central focus of technological development. Advances in renewable energy, energy storage, and carbon capture are driving a green revolution that promises to significantly reduce humanity’s environmental footprint.
Key Technologies Driving Sustainability:
- Solar and Wind Energy: Both solar and wind energy have become more efficient and cost-effective by 2025. Advances in solar panel technology have dramatically reduced the cost of generating electricity, while wind turbines are becoming more powerful and capable of producing energy in a wider range of environments.
- Energy Storage: Breakthroughs in battery technology have made energy storage more efficient and scalable, allowing renewable energy to be stored for later use. This addresses one of the biggest challenges of renewable energy—intermittency—and allows for a more stable and reliable energy grid.
- Carbon Capture and Sequestration: Technologies that capture and store carbon emissions are being deployed at scale, helping industries reduce their carbon footprint. These technologies are critical for achieving global climate goals and preventing further global warming.
As climate change becomes an even more urgent global issue, technological advancements in renewable energy and sustainability are critical to creating a more eco-friendly future.
6. Biotechnology: Advancements in Medicine and Agriculture
In 2025, biotechnology has seen major advancements that promise to transform healthcare and agriculture. The use of gene-editing technologies like CRISPR is paving the way for groundbreaking treatments and solutions to previously incurable diseases.
Breakthroughs in Biotechnology:
- Gene Therapy: By 2025, gene therapy has been used to treat genetic disorders like sickle cell anemia, cystic fibrosis, and even certain forms of cancer. CRISPR-based therapies have enabled precise editing of DNA, correcting mutations at the genetic level to cure diseases.
- Agricultural Biotechnology: Genetically modified crops are helping to feed a growing global population by making plants more resistant to pests, diseases, and environmental stresses. These crops are more efficient, requiring fewer pesticides and less water, making them essential for food security in a changing climate.
- Personalized Medicine: Advances in genomics have allowed for more personalized treatment plans based on an individual’s genetic makeup. In 2025, treatments for conditions like cancer, heart disease, and neurological disorders are increasingly being tailored to each patient’s unique biology, improving effectiveness and reducing side effects.
Biotechnology in 2025 is fundamentally improving health outcomes and addressing the challenges of feeding the world in a sustainable way.
